Taylorsville is a locality in Salt Lake County, Utah, United States. It has a population of 58,678. The population density is 2100.8 people per km². Taylorsville is located at 40.6677°N, 111.9388°W. It observes the Mountain Time (America/Denver) timezone. ZIP code: 84123.

It lies 2.7 miles west of Murray, UT (from Murray, UT: bearing 271°T), and is situated 6.9 miles south-south-west of Salt Lake City. The story of Taylorsville is one of agrarian roots that have been steadily overlaid by suburban sprawl. Once, this was the domain of farms and orchards, a place where the rhythm of planting and harvest dictated the seasons. The legacy of that agricultural past can still be glimpsed in the occasional weathered barn or the enduring green of well-maintained lawns, a gentle echo of the land’s former identity. Today, Taylorsville’s economy is largely driven by its residential character, a bedroom community supporting the larger Salt Lake Valley’s commercial heart.
